DIY Club: Homemade Lamp Using Scratch (Bamboo Stick Lamps)




This is a unique and creative DIY lamp made from natural scratch materials like kano k teelo and khaso khashak. It gives a soft, warm, and traditional look to your room.

🛠️ Materials Required

  • Kaanay kay teelay (dry grass sticks) / khaso khashak

  • Balloon or plastic ball (for shape)

  • Glue (white glue or glue gun)

  • Small LED bulb

  • Bulb holder

  • Electric wire + plug

  • Plastic cup or small stand (base)

  • Cutter / scissors

⚙️ Step-by-Step Process

1. Make Base Shape

  • Inflate a balloon or use a plastic ball

  • This will be the shape of your lamp

2. Apply Scratch Material

  • Dip teelay/khashak in glue

  • Start placing them around the balloon randomly

  • Leave small gaps for light effect

  • Cover 70–80% area only

3. Let It Dry

  • Leave it for 6–8 hours until fully dry

  • Once hard, burst and remove the balloon carefully

4. Prepare Lighting Setup

  • Fix bulb holder inside or at the bottom

  • Pass wire through base

  • Connect plug and switch

⚠️ Use only LED bulb (low heat) for safety

5. Fix the Lamp

  • Place the dried scratch structure on a cup or stand

  • Fix it properly with glue

6. Final Touch

  • Trim extra sticks

  • You can spray paint (gold, brown, or natural color looks best)

💡 Tips

  • Do not use high heat bulbs

  • Keep design airy for better lighting effect

  • You can make different shapes (round, oval, hanging lamp)
